What is the best playing position to take in a singles game?

    Disregarding the professional singles game, I would think that the best playing position in a singles match is in the center of the court, halfway between the side alley lines, at the baseline. By positioning yourself at either side of the court (left versus the right) your opponent could more easily hit the ball to the opposite side, forcing you to run to ball and making it more difficult to repositions yourself for the shot. In terms of distance from the net, I think it depends on the type of shot your opponent makes and the type of player you are. If your opponent is a defensive player, meaning he or she plays well behind the baseline, it may be advantageous to play more at the net with more aggressive shots, which tend to give the easiest/most points in a match. It is difficult to make clean winners from a baseline rally, unless you are an expert in hitting passing shots or angle shots. :) [Though one thing to keep in mind when playing at the net--it is much easier for your opponent to lob the ball over your head which drives you backwards to get the ball and thus play defensively, which will reduce the chance of you scoring a point against him/her.] If your opponent is playing aggressively it would be in your advantage to play defensively because it is easier to estimate where the shot is going to be placed and for you to have more time to react because you have a greater distance separating you from your opponent and his/her shot [shots from the net usually can be hit with more pace and thus can be more difficult to get if you are close to the net too.] Generally you have to respond and react to your opponent's play to determine the best playing position, and I think would constantly change through the duration of the match.
